Transaction 7528476f8b422c16c8d2ce417b22937e72674cb038d7d6c1c889c15f2a620f3e
1 Input
1 Output
-
7528476f8b422c16c8d2ce417b22937e72674cb038d7d6c1c889c15f2a620f3e:0
- value
- 396164
- script pubkey
- OP_0 OP_PUSHBYTES_20 e98e468846e91986357ae08530ab8e51654c221f
- address
- bc1qax8ydzzxayvcvdt6uzznp2uw29j5cgslf9verl